What are Solar Wire Lugs?
Solar wire lugs are specialized connectors designed to secure wires to solar panels and other electrical components within a solar energy system. They are typically made of copper or aluminum, materials known for their excellent conductivity. These lugs provide a reliable and secure electrical connection, ensuring efficient energy transfer from the solar panels to your home or business.
Why are Solar Wire Lugs Essential?
- Efficiency: Loose or corroded connections can significantly reduce the efficiency of your solar panel system. Wire lugs create tight, secure connections, minimizing energy loss and maximizing the amount of electricity your panels generate.
- Safety: Faulty electrical connections can pose a serious fire hazard. Solar wire lugs are designed to withstand high temperatures and prevent electrical arcing, ensuring the safety of your solar energy system.
- Longevity: The harsh outdoor environment can take a toll on electrical connections. Solar wire lugs are made of durable materials that resist corrosion and degradation, extending the lifespan of your solar panel system.
Types of Solar Wire Lugs
- Crimp Lugs: These are the most common type of solar wire lug. They are secured by crimping them onto the wire using a specialized tool. Crimp lugs are known for their reliability and ease of installation.
- Solder Lugs: These lugs are soldered onto the wire, creating a permanent bond. While soldering requires more skill than crimping, it can provide a more robust connection in some situations.
- Mechanical Lugs: These lugs use a screw or bolt to secure the wire. They are less common than crimp or solder lugs but offer the advantage of being reusable.
Choosing the Right Solar Wire Lugs
When selecting solar wire lugs, consider the following factors:
- Material: Copper is the preferred material for solar wire lugs due to its superior conductivity. However, aluminum lugs are a more affordable option and still provide adequate performance.
- Size: Choose lugs that are compatible with the gauge of the wires you are using. Using the wrong size lug can result in a poor connection.
- Type: The best type of lug for your system will depend on your skill level and the specific requirements of your installation.

Maintenance
Regular inspection and maintenance of your solar wire lugs are essential for ensuring the optimal performance and safety of your solar panel system. Here’s what you need to know:
- Frequency: It’s recommended to inspect your wire lugs at least twice a year, particularly before and after the peak seasons for solar energy production.
- Visual Inspection: Look for signs of corrosion, damage, or loose connections. Corrosion can reduce the conductivity of the lugs, while loose connections can lead to increased resistance and energy loss.
- Tightening: If you find any loose connections, carefully tighten the lugs using the appropriate tools. Avoid overtightening, as this can damage the lugs or wires.
- Replacement: If you discover any severely corroded or damaged lugs, replace them immediately with new ones.
By following these maintenance guidelines, you can help ensure that your solar wire lugs remain in optimal condition, contributing to the long-term efficiency and safety of your solar panel system.
